Waiting for Forever is a romantic drama film released in 2010, directed by James Keach. The movie highlights the emotional turmoil of two friends living completely contrasting lives, Will Donner and Emma Twist, played by Tom Sturridge and Rachel Bilson respectively. Will is shown to be a charming, quirky and happy-go-lucky goofball who is madly in love with Emma since they were little children living in the same neighborhood. Emma, on the other hand, is a beautiful and successful actress who is too engrossed in her professional life to realize Will's love for her. Despite the distance and different paths they've taken in life, Will never lost track of Emma, as he travels across the country to be near her, hoping that someday she will return his feelings.

The story of Waiting for Forever is narrated through Will and Emma's perspectives, revealing the distance that the two have grown apart emotionally. Emma has moved on in her life, with no inclination towards having any relationships with anyone, let alone Will. Will, on the other hand, has continued to follow Emma from city to city hoping to make an impression on her. However, Emma is still unaware of his love for her, as she sees Will as just a childhood friend she had grown up with.

Waiting for Forever is a 2010 drama with a runtime of 1 hour and 39 minutes. It has received mostly poor reviews from critics and viewers, who have given it an IMDb score of 5.9 and a MetaScore of 26.
